Of late there have been really bad smells around the area and last night was particularly bad. We rang the EPA to complain and were told that they are going to be doing further surveys around the area.
I would suggest that if you have issues with odours around the area, to do the following:
During tip operating hours: Contact SITA on 9554 4555. If there are odours during that time they can try to do something about it. If you aren't happy with what SITA says, then contact the EPA.
Outside tip operating hours: Contact EPA on 9695 2777. Check their Polwatch web site for further details.

The other day I received an email from a Lynbrook complaining about
odours from the Hallam Rd landfill (or at least that was the
assumption). I sent off an email to the Operations Manager and received
the following reply:
We
became aware of this about 2 weeks ago during these very still nights
and early mornings.
We
found that the recent rains had washed some of the soil cover off in a
few locations forming a few deep furrows.
These
areas have now been recovered with additional soil and this problem
should have been rectified.
There
has also been some soil blending with animal manure by some landowners
in the general area. If we receive any reports of odour we can try and
trace it back you.
Although
it is difficult to do anything after hours as our planning permit
prevents the use of any machines if anyone who has a concern would like
to send me an email with their details I can return a call first thing
the next day and investigate.
